Nonprofits and their staff are undervalued, under-appreciated, and un-relenting. Brittny and Nia stand shoulder-to-shoulder with these amazing, incredible staff and talk about the realities of the sector that nobody wants to talk about.


This is NOT another nonprofit best practices podcast. Topics covered include dysfunctional boards, gala mishaps, the issues with philanthropy and so much more!

Problems with In-Kind Donations

Listen as we barely keep it together, discussing the outrageous in-kind donations we’ve been given, what to do with them and how to politely say, "NO." Episode Highlights A Quick Definition: In-kind donation is a gift of goods (physical items) or services that are donated to a nonprofit. Why are in-kind donations important to nonprofit organizations? Overhead

Overhead is confusing and a ridiculous measure of a nonprofit’s value, impact, and success. And yet, we keep having to talk about it. Episode Highlights ● What is the “Overhead Myth”? ● How are other organizations perpetuating it? ● How can donors truly evaluate the effectiveness of a nonprofit? ● New Hashtags from Brittny: #ItsAllTheWork ● To restrict or not to restrict when giving.
